Block

#21,724,618
Block Number
21,724,618 @ 05/20/2025, 21:09:40
Status
Finalized
ID
0x014b7dca57af1d5370c2875d093e50a2db4378f7d4d00b535c304e3e8125690f
Transactions
Gas Used
5073226/39999962 (12.68% Used)
Total Score
2,121,674,455 (+98)
Rewards
18.44 VTHO